Abstract

Analyzing the data recorded with the MD-1 detector operated at the VEPP-4 storage ring we have determined the ϒ(1S) resonance leptonic partial width and mass. We find $$\begin{gathered} \Gamma _{ee} = 1.29 \pm 0.03 \pm 0.03keV, \hfill \\ M = 9460.59 \pm 0.09 \pm 0.05MeV/c^2 \hfill \\ \end{gathered} $$ M=9460.59±0.09±0.05 MeV/c<superscript>2</superscript>. This new value of the ϒ(1S) mass should supersede the previously published value [11] based on almost the same statistics.
